- Title
Every medal has its flip side: the effects of mixed military teams on conflict intensity and cohesion.
- Authors
ESSIG, Elena; SOPARNOT, Richard
- Abstract
Numerous scientific studies have delved into the effects of gender diversity in the workplace on the functioning of organizations and teams. Nonetheless, the literature appears to lack a unanimous consensus. Views fluctuate between the presence of positive or negative effects, their absence, and the proposal of an optimal diversity rate. Our research thus turns its attention to the impact of gender diversity on conflict intensity and cohesion in our study. To scrutinize this topic, we implemented both quantitative and qualitative methodologies with a participant pool of 124 non-commissioned officers from the French Air Force, divided into 21 teams. Our findings suggest that teams manifesting certain diversity rates demonstrate superior outcomes concerning conflict intensity and team cohesion.
